The A-800PRO Editor for Mac and PC makes it a breeze to customize the A-800PRO for use with your favorite synth or DAW. And the sure-grip, rubber-coated Pitch Bend/Modulation Stick offers expressive control of both functions at the same time. Whether you’re playing your favorite virtual instrument or working in your digital audio workstation, 9 knobs, 9 sliders, 4 buttons, and a dedicated Transport section offers fully assignable control of all the features you need. All controls are easily accessible and intelligently laid out to make performing and producing music an inspiring affair. The A-800PRO has been ergonomically designed to put everything at your fingertips. Connect USB, MIDI IN/OUT, Hold and Expression pedals without having to reach behind the keyboard. The A-800PRO provides easy access connections on the side panel so that you can have a computer monitor or laptop in the ideal position behind the keyboard ― a must for educational use. No matter what your skill level, you’ll appreciate the feel of a quality instrument when you play the A-800PRO. And with selectable Velocity curves you can fine tune the A-800PRO to match your playing style. Plus, enhancements have been made to eliminate vertical shake and reduce the already low mechanical noise on key strokes. Rounded key assemblies offer responsive reaction to your touch and more comfortable glissando. A superior key mechanism provides aftertouch and and increased sensitivity for a wide range of expressive dynamics in your performance. With so many great midi keyboards on the market, it can be tough to decide exactly what you want, especially if you’re also learning a DAW at the same time. Double-check the specs for compatibility before purchasing if you want to go this route. You can also connect MIDI keyboards to smartphones and notebooks, though these are technically computers, just smaller than your laptop or desktop. MIDI keyboards themselves don’t produce sound, so they need to be connected to something that can-like a hardware synth or sound module. The short answer is yes, but whether that is something you’ll want to do depends on your goals. Q: Can you use a MIDI keyboard without a computer? You should also be aware that If you want to use your midi keyboard with a smartphone or notebook, you may need to purchase a separate battery pack so the device has sufficient power. If you’re adding it to a performance setup, drum pads and inputs for a sustain or expression pedal can be important features to have.

PortabilityĬhoosing a portable midi keyboard isn’t just about size or number of keys. Feel of Keys and KnobsĪre you the type of musician or creator who likes turning a guitar amp up to 11, hitting a cymbal with the grace of a ballet dancer, or sitting down at an upright piano to find inspiration? If so, look for midi keyboards with knobs, velocity sensitivity, and control wheels rather than touch strips and mini keys, which can feel more like tech input devices and less like analog instruments. For example, piano players and professionally trained musicians may prefer weighted keys and bigger keyboards, while DIY musicians may gravitate toward touch-sensitive drum pads and built-in DAW integration that works right out of the box. How you make the music in your chosen genre will also shape your choice of midi keyboard.
